Responsibilities:
- Responsible for operations of SDH/DWDM Transmission equipment, backbone transmission networks and Network Management System (NMS)
- Test and provision of SDH/DWDM, voice, IP, carrier Ethernet backbone circuits and local loops
- Perform pre-service testing and implementation of transmission links
- Make arrangement with vendor/customer for repair of the system equipment.
- Perform regular back-up of system configuration and performance data in the Network Management System (NMS) and Element Manager Layer (EML) servers
- Supervise the installation and upgrading of station facilities equipment and ensure that the project is implemented in the schedule timeline
- Be part of the project team to deploy (install, test and commission) DWDM network and subsequently provide the maintenance support
- Support Project manager to liaise with customers, team members and partners on network deployment and acceptance testing
- Perform any other duties from the project manager or maintenance manager.
- As project engineer and responsible for accomplishment of acceptance of the network at site
- To supervise and manage the contractors on site doing the physical activities
- To provide inputs to project manager as and when needed.
- Provide regular and timely project progress update to the customer/project manager
- Handle the incidents and provide quality maintenance support for the network

About Singtel
Headquartered in Singapore, Singtel has 140 years of operating experience and played a pivotal role in the country’s development as a major communications hub. Optus, our subsidiary in Australia, is a leader in integrated telecommunications, constantly raising the bar in innovative products and services.
We are also strategically invested in leading companies in Asia and Africa, including Bharti Airtel (India, South Asia and Africa), Telkomsel (Indonesia), Globe Telecom (the Philippines) and Advanced Info Service (Thailand). We work closely with our associates, leveraging our scale in networks, customer reach and extensive operational experience to lead and shape the communications industry.
Together, the Group serves over 700 million mobile customers around world. Singtel is one of the largest listed Singapore companies on the Singapore Exchange by market capitalisation.
The Group has a vast network of offices throughout Asia Pacific, Europe and the USA, and employs more than 23,000 staff worldwide.
